How To Post Pictures

Okay - so the last thread still had a lot of people confused on the process.

The number one question! Follow these steps with screenshots included to learn how exactly to post pictures.

1. First of all, sign up for a free (if you choose) image hosting service. This can be found at http://www.photobucket.com . Alternatively, you may choose to use Tinypic http://www.tinypic.com/ or imageshack http://www.imageshack.us/ if you don't want to sign up for an account.

Photobucket http://www.photobucket.com

After you have activated your account in photobucket, upload your picture and it will be uploaded as a box like this.





COPY and PASTE EXACTLY what you see in that [ IMG ] category. (as pointed to by black arrow.)


Imageshack http://www.imageshack.us/

Choose your picture and click "host it".









COPY and PASTE EXACTLY what you see in that (Hotlink for forums (1) category. (as pointed to by black arrow.)

Tinypic http://www.tinypic.com/





Choose your picture and click "host it".





COPY and PASTE EXACTLY what you see in that [ IMG ] category. (as pointed to by black arrow.)



You may use this thread to conduct your tests.

Make sure when looking for the pictures you have taken in game, look in the EA Games/The Sims 2/Neighbourhood # (Number)/Storytelling folder. NOT in the EA Games/The Sims 2/Storytelling folder.

Alternatively, you may choose to click prt scrn while in game and paste the picture onto MS Paint. This increases the size and quality of pictures. Remember to resize to 650x550 though!

MCR: When you go to upload the pictures, are you uploading one called thumbnail_bunchanumbersandstuff or snapshot_bunchanumbersandstuff? Thumbnail is the image that shows in the blog format of your stories. Snapshot is the big one for story mode. Snapshot is normally towards the front of your storytelling folder and thumbnail is towards the back.

If you have university, it's C:/My Documents/EA Games/Neighborhoods/N001/Storytelling
The N001 is for Pleasantview. Strangetown is N002, Veronaville is N003, etc. etc.
Without Uni it's C:/My Documents/EA Games/Storytelling and they'll all bee together. Good luck!
